Commission Details
You will be happy to know that Hearts Affiliates offers you up to 50% on commissions, but keep in mind that this will depend on your performance. The primary commission structure will be as follows:
Net Gaming Revenue Commission Percentage
€ 0 – €5 000 25%
€ 5 001 – €10 000 30%
€ 10 001 – €15 000 35%
€ 15 001 – €30 000 40%
€ 30 001 – €50 000 45%
€ 50 000 and more. 50%
Carryover policy
If you had a bad month, you do not need to worry because the program will have your back with a no-negative carryover policy.
CPA
CPA plans and hybrid plans are available upon request; they do not define how much you can earn under these kinds of plans, so you will have to negotiate with your account manager.
